Battle heroics earn airman a Bronze Star


Staff report
Posted : Tuesday Jul 31, 2007 15:57:26 EDT

A security forces airman was awarded the Bronze Star with Valor and the Army Commendation Medal for defeating an ambush by more than 100 Taliban fighters with zero coalition casualties.

Staff Sgt. Jason A. Kimberling, 366th Security Forces Squadron, received his medals July 19 for actions Aug. 8, 2006, in Qalat province, Afghanistan.

Kimberling was part of a three-person security forces convoy team traveling with 15 members of the Afghan National Police and 20 members of the Afghan National Army. Their convoy came under ambush on a highway checkpoint near a residential area.

Rocket-propelled grenades and machine guns were being fired from multiple angles. Kimberling jumped out of his Humvee only to be thrown to the ground by an RPG blast. He took cover behind a wall, but two Taliban fighters charged his position. He shot both men and was able to rally the coalition forces to maneuver and kill other nearby fighters.

Kimberling, knowing Dutch NATO fighter planes were nearby, called for air support. The planes blasted enemy positions and allowed the coalition fighters to maintain their fallback position during the two-hour gunfight. The sergeant’s actions prevented the coalition forces from being divided and overrun. In the end, about 20 Taliban fighters were dead, but all Afghan and U.S. troops escaped unscathed.

“They’re calling me a hero,” Kimberling said during his ceremony. “I don’t think I did anything special. I went out there to do my job.”

Air Force Staff Sgt. Jason Kimberling was awarded the Bronze Star with Valor on July 19 at Mountain Home Air Force Base, Idaho, by Col. Thomas Laffey.
